Surfers for Climate is a registered environment nonprofit based in Byron Bay, Nsw, Australia. It is registered with the Australian Charities and Not-for-profits Commission (ACNC). It was founded in 2020 and has been operating for 6 years. Its registration number is 83642508781. It has a GiveRadar Integrity Assessment of 44/100 (Partial transparency), indicating some public data is available but key signals are missing. The organization reports A$397K in annual revenue.

Surfers for Climate has a GiveRadar Integrity Assessment of 44/100. This score combines five components: Registration (20 pts), Financial Transparency (30 pts), Governance (20 pts), Contact Availability (10 pts), and Data Recency (20 pts), with negative adjustments for any red flags. A score of 44 ('Partial transparency') means some public data is on file but key signals are missing - worth a closer look before donating. For comparison, the average integrity assessment for environment charities in Australia is 53/100.

Surfers for Climate is registered with the Australian Charities and Not-for-profits Commission (ACNC). If the organization has Deductible Gift Recipient (DGR) status, donations of $2 or more are tax-deductible in Australia. Check the organization's DGR status on the ACNC or ATO website to confirm.
